zookeeper启动错误 ---- Unable to load database on disk
zk启动报错
解决办法,进入zkdata目录删除version-2下面的所有文件
参考:
https://issues.apache.org/jira/browse/ZOOKEEPER-1546
[hadoop@slave1 bin]$ cat zookeeper.out
2017-09-06 20:38:53,468 [myid:] - INFO  [main:QuorumPeerConfig@134] - Reading configuration from: /usr/local/zookeeper/zookeeper-3.4.10/bin/../conf/zoo.cfg
2017-09-06 20:38:53,486 [myid:] - INFO  [main:QuorumPeer$QuorumServer@167] - Resolved hostname: slave3 to address: slave3/192.168.1.198
2017-09-06 20:38:53,487 [myid:] - INFO  [main:QuorumPeer$QuorumServer@167] - Resolved hostname: slave2 to address: slave2/192.168.1.197
2017-09-06 20:38:53,487 [myid:] - INFO  [main:QuorumPeer$QuorumServer@167] - Resolved hostname: slave1 to address: slave1/192.168.1.196
2017-09-06 20:38:53,487 [myid:] - INFO  [main:QuorumPeerConfig@396] - Defaulting to majority quorums
2017-09-06 20:38:53,490 [myid:1] - INFO  [main:DatadirCleanupManager@78] - autopurge.snapRetainCount set to 3
2017-09-06 20:38:53,490 [myid:1] - INFO  [main:DatadirCleanupManager@79] - autopurge.purgeInterval set to 0
2017-09-06 20:38:53,490 [myid:1] - INFO  [main:DatadirCleanupManager@101] - Purge task is not scheduled.
2017-09-06 20:38:53,501 [myid:1] - INFO  [main:QuorumPeerMain@127] - Starting quorum peer
2017-09-06 20:38:53,509 [myid:1] - INFO  [main:NIOServerCnxnFactory@89] - binding to port 0.0.0.0/0.0.0.0:2181
2017-09-06 20:38:53,526 [myid:1] - INFO  [main:QuorumPeer@1134] - minSessionTimeout set to -1
2017-09-06 20:38:53,526 [myid:1] - INFO  [main:QuorumPeer@1145] - maxSessionTimeout set to -1
2017-09-06 20:38:53,526 [myid:1] - INFO  [main:QuorumPeer@1419] - QuorumPeer communication is not secured!
2017-09-06 20:38:53,526 [myid:1] - INFO  [main:QuorumPeer@1448] - quorum.cnxn.threads.size set to 20
2017-09-06 20:38:53,529 [myid:1] - INFO  [main:FileSnap@83] - Reading snapshot /home/hadoop/zookeeper/zkdata/version-2/snapshot.400000000
2017-09-06 20:38:53,890 [myid:1] - ERROR [main:Util@239] - Last transaction was partial.
2017-09-06 20:38:53,896 [myid:1] - ERROR [main:QuorumPeer@648] - Unable to load database on disk
java.io.IOException: The current epoch, 12, is older than the last zxid, 81604378626
	at org.apache.zookeeper.server.quorum.QuorumPeer.loadDataBase(QuorumPeer.java:630)
	at org.apache.zookeeper.server.quorum.QuorumPeer.start(QuorumPeer.java:591)
	at org.apache.zookeeper.server.quorum.QuorumPeerMain.runFromConfig(QuorumPeerMain.java:164)
	at org.apache.zookeeper.server.quorum.QuorumPeerMain.initializeAndRun(QuorumPeerMain.java:111)
	at org.apache.zookeeper.server.quorum.QuorumPeerMain.main(QuorumPeerMain.java:78)
2017-09-06 20:38:53,899 [myid:1] - ERROR [main:QuorumPeerMain@89] - Unexpected exception, exiting abnormally
java.lang.RuntimeException: Unable to run quorum server
	at org.apache.zookeeper.server.quorum.QuorumPeer.loadDataBase(QuorumPeer.java:649)
	at org.apache.zookeeper.server.quorum.QuorumPeer.start(QuorumPeer.java:591)
	at org.apache.zookeeper.server.quorum.QuorumPeerMain.runFromConfig(QuorumPeerMain.java:164)
	at org.apache.zookeeper.server.quorum.QuorumPeerMain.initializeAndRun(QuorumPeerMain.java:111)
	at org.apache.zookeeper.server.quorum.QuorumPeerMain.main(QuorumPeerMain.java:78)
Caused by: java.io.IOException: The current epoch, 12, is older than the last zxid, 81604378626
	at org.apache.zookeeper.server.quorum.QuorumPeer.loadDataBase(QuorumPeer.java:630)
	... 4 more
zookeeper启动错误 ---- Unable to load database on disk的更多相关文章
- zookeeper无法启动"Unable to load database on disk"
		自己的虚拟机集群.一次强制关机后,发现slave2的zookeeper起不来了 http://blog.csdn.net/ashic/article/details/47088299 下午5点29:5 ... 
- zookeeper无法启动"Unable to load database on disk
		QuorumPeerMain,ResourceManager都没有起来 resourcemanager.log如下 2018-09-28 23:17:02,787 FATAL org.apache.h ... 
- Linux x64 Hadoop-2.4.1配置-解决错误Unable to load native-hadoop library for your platform
		网上配置hadoop的教程一堆,各不尽相同,但没有一个是完整系统的. 下面给出遇到的错误的解决方法,相信能解决很多人的问题. 错误:Exception in thread "main&quo ... 
- zookeeper启动错误 transaction type: 2 error: KeeperErrorCode = NoNode for /hbase
		hbase伪分布式,与zookeeper同一台机器的时候,运行一段时间,启动zookeeper的时候,日志中有如下错误,导致无法启动zookeeper java.io.IOException: Fai ... 
- 忘记导入struts2-xxx-plugin-x.x.x.jar导致服务器启动报Unable to load configuration.Caused by: Parent package is not defined: xxx-default
		今天做的一个Struts2+MyFaces(JSF)+Spring的应用,为了使用JSF,我的struts.xml中使用了如下代码 <package name="jsf" e ... 
- Zookeeper 启动错误
		启动后日志如下 : 2016-09-14 05:51:19,449 [myid:1] - INFO [QuorumPeer[myid=1]/0:0:0:0:0:0:0:0:2181:FastLeade ... 
- Eclipse的SVN插件提示:验证验证位置时发生错误:"Unable to load default SVN Client“解决
		这个原因是你的机器上没有 JAVAHL 这个包, 这个是另外的一个开源组件, 所以, 在trigis的svn插件发行版里面没有这个东西,下载装上就是, 这个包在不同的系统上, 有不同的情况...详情见 ... 
- zookeeper启动入口
		最近正在研究zookeeper,一些心得记录一下,如有错误,还请大神指正. zookeeper下载地址:http://zookeeper.apache.org/releases.html,百度一下就能 ... 
- zookeeper源码学习一——zookeeper启动
		最近正在研究zookeeper,一些心得记录一下,如有错误,还请大神指正. zookeeper下载地址:http://zookeeper.apache.org/releases.html,百度一下就能 ... 
随机推荐
- (转)myeclipse工程 junit不能运行 ClassNotFoundException
			博文转自:http://www.cnblogs.com/java-zone/articles/2730722.html myeclipse工程 junit不能运行 1 2 3 4 5 6 7 8 ... 
- Codeforces Round #352 (Div. 2) C
			C. Recycling Bottles time limit per test 2 seconds memory limit per test 256 megabytes input standar ... 
- JNDI连接数据库的详细步骤 以及简要的c3po数据库连接的配置
			第一步在tomcat的context.xml文件中配置数据源:context.xml的路径形式是:D:\Program Files (x86)\apache-tomcat-6.0.44\conf\co ... 
- FastDfs java客户端上传、删除文件
			#配置文件 connect_timeout = 2 network_timeout = 30 charset = UTF-8 http.tracker_http_port = 9090 http.an ... 
- 汕头市队赛 SRM 07 C 整洁的麻将桌
			C 整洁的麻将桌 SRM 07 背景&&描述 天才麻将少女KPM立志要在日麻界闯出一番名堂. KPM上周双打了n场麻将,但她这次没控分,而且因为是全民参与的麻将大赛,所以她的名 ... 
- NGINX: 优化 use 参数
			转自:http://blog.sina.com.cn/s/blog_5eaf88f10100gkrq.html Nginx use参数分析对比 下图对比了poll select epoll和kqueu ... 
- UML笔记(3):顺序图、Sequence Diagram
			http://www.cnblogs.com/xueyuangudiao/archive/2011/09/22/2185364.html 目录 含义 要素: 1 活动者 2 对象 3 生命线 4 控制 ... 
- pymongo.errors.BulkWriteError错误排解
			在mongodb进行数据库操作的时候触发异常 pymongo Error: pymongo.errors.BulkWriteError: batch op errors occurred 这种问题 ... 
- python的递归算法学习(3):汉诺塔递归算法
			汉诺塔问题是递归函数的经典应用,它来自一个古老传说:在世界刚被创建的时候有一座钻石宝塔A,其上有64个金蝶.所有碟子按从大到小的次序从塔底堆放至塔顶.紧挨着这座塔有另外两个钻石宝塔B和C.从世界创始之 ... 
- MSSQL-字符串分离与列记录合并成一行混合使用
			一般我们在数据库的表字段存储字典Id,如果有多个的话一般是用,或分隔符分隔(12,14),列表显示的时候是显示字典名,那如果要在数据库将字典Id转成用户看得懂的字典名,该怎么办呢? 我们这时候可以结合 ... 
